Establishing nomogram of blood pressure for late adolescents in India: Secondary analysis of NFHS-4 data

Abhishek Jaiswal 1, Vignesh Dwarakanathan 1, P Ananda Selva Das 1, Garima Singh 2, Ramadass Sathiyamoorthy 3, Trideep Jyoti Deori 1, Sumit Malhotra 1, Nidhi Jaswal 4, Sonu Goel 5,
PMCID: PMC9731007  PMID: 36505550

Abstract

Background:

Hypertension among adolescents is a public health problem, which is going to become more severe given the current obesity epidemic. There is a scarcity of information on the reference range value for blood pressure (BP) cut-off for adolescents.

Aim:

We aimed to establish BP distribution in adolescents aged 15–19 years by using the nationally representative National Family Health Survey-4 (NFHS-4) data.

Materials and Methods:

We analyzed the data of 15,936 boys and 1,04,132 girls aged 15–19 years in the NFHS-4 survey. We took the mean of systolic and diastolic BPs. Height for age z scores for each individual was calculated using the WHO Anthro plus. The sampling weight was taken as provided by the demographic and health surveys (DHS) website. Nomograms of systolic and diastolic BPs were made by calculating their 50th, 90th, and 95th percentiles for each age (in months), gender, and height percentile for age categories.

Results:

Both systolic and diastolic BPs increased with age and height centiles. The BP was higher in boys than girls. The average annual increase in systolic and diastolic BPs was 2.52 and 1.20 mmHg in boys and 0.50 and 0.46 mmHg in girls, respectively, when adjusted for height centiles.

Conclusion:

This study provides a BP nomogram that can be generalized to all the Indian population. Research is required for the diagnostic performance of this nomogram for the diagnosis of adolescent hypertension.

Introduction

Hypertension among adolescents is a growing public health problem,[1] which persists in their adulthood and old age. Given the current obesity epidemic, the burden of adolescent hypertension can be expected to increase. The prevalence of clinical hypertension in children and adolescents is ∼3.5% and the prevalence of persistently elevated blood pressure (BP) is ∼2.2 to 3.5%, with higher rates among overweight and obese children and adolescents.[2]

The causes for hypertension among adolescents may be primary (or essential) or secondary due to other diseases. Secondary hypertension is more common than primary among adolescents which is in sharp contrast to adults.[3] The initiating process which leads to changes in trophins such as insulin-like growth factor-1, cortisol, catecholamines, and angiotensin has possible long-term effects which may also lead to progressive changes in the blood vessels’ structure and other cardiovascular effects.[4]

The diagnosis of hypertension and elevated BP in children or adolescents is made when there are three different BP readings and ≥90th percentile, respectively. The updated definition of BP categories and stages according to the American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) and National High Blood Pressure Education Program (NHBPEP) Working Group on Children and Adolescents is provided in Table 1.[2,5]

Table 1.

BP categories and stages according to the AAP and NHBPEP

Blood pressure categories Children aged ≥13 years (AAP) NHBPEP
Normal BP <120/<80 mmHg SBP or DBP <90th percentile for age and height percentile
Elevated BP 120/<80 mmHg-129/<80 mmHg SBP or DBP between 90th and 95th percentile for age and height percentile
Stage 1 HTN 130/80-139/89 mmHg SBP or DBP between 95th and 99th percentile for age and height percentile
Stage 2 HTN ≥140/90 mmHg SBP or DBP >99th percentile for age and height percentile

These reference values are derived from a multi-ethnic pediatric population from the USA. Because of the influence of multiple factors like race, ethnicity, genetic and environmental determinants, the reference standards of one population might not be relevant in others.[6,7] There is a very limited number of studies to establish a reference standard for BP distribution among adolescents in India and these studies were conducted on a small scale with small sample size. Establishing a nomogram of BP of adolescents requires consideration of a few factors. Age is one of the main determinants of BP values.[8] BP increases with age and more abruptly during puberty. Another important determinant is sex, with a higher prevalence of hypertension among boys. Height also determines the value of BP.[6] Other risk factors for hypertension in children include obesity, race, ethnicity, disordered sleep, family history of hypertension, low-birth weight, and maternal smoking during pregnancy.[1] Data tracking from childhood to adulthood has shown that high BP in childhood correlates with higher BP in adulthood. Hence, the diagnosis and treatment of hypertension are of paramount importance in late adolescents.[2]

Thus, in the present study, we aimed to establish BP distribution in adolescents aged 15–19 years by using the nationally representative National Family Health Survey-4 (NFHS-4) data.

Materials and Methods

Data source and sample size

The NFHS is a nationally represented, large-scale survey conducted in multiple rounds. The NFHS-4 was conducted by the International Institute of Population Sciences (IIPS) and Ministry of Health and Family Welfare, India, from January 2015 to December 2016, covering approximately 6 lakh households. NFHS-4 was representative at the level of districts. A total of 7 lakh women and about 1.1 lakh men were interviewed using a structured tool. Men and women between 15 and 19 years of age were considered and the rest were omitted. Data on BP mainly came from the household member dataset.

Data collection

The piloting of NFHS-4 was conducted before the survey which included 147 household interviews (including BP measurement in 181 adults). Along with this, three ToT (training of trainers) were conducted by International Institute for Population Sciences (IIPS). The trainers who participated were responsible for training all field workers throughout India. The biomarker measurement training and procedures are explained in detail in the NFHS-4 biomarker questionnaire.[9]

Before measuring BP, the arm circumference was measured to use an appropriate size cuff. Systolic and diastolic BPs were measured thrice using a standard digital sphygmomanometer (Portable Omron BP monitor, model HEM-8712) on the same arm, with an interval of at least 5 min between each BP measurement. The participants were asked to sit and relax for 5 min before taking the first reading.[9]

Data analysis and statistical methods

Data were analyzed in STATA v. 12 (StataCorp, College Station, Tx).[10] Age was calculated by date of birth and date of interview to get age in completed months. We took the mean of systolic and diastolic BP readings. Those with systolic BP more than 270 mmHg or less than 40 mmHg, and diastolic BP more than 140 mmHg or less than 10 mmHg were omitted from the analysis. If a reading was missing, we took the mean of the remaining readings. We calculated height for age z scores using the WHO Anthro plus macro.[11] Individuals with height for age z score less than -5 and more than +5 were omitted from the analysis. Survey methods were used for estimating the centile values of systolic and diastolic BP. The height for age z-scores were converted to height for age centiles and categorized (Supplementary Tables S1S4). Sampling weights were considered for multi-stage sampling and clustering. Appropriate sampling weights (hv028 and hv005) were considered for men and women, respectively. The primary sampling unit and strata were defined as provided on the DHS website.[12] Stata command “svyset” with “centered” option was used due to single strata within a few primary sampling units. Then, the 50th, 90th, and 95th percentile systolic and diastolic BP values were calculated and tabulated separately for males and females, for each age (in months) and height percentile category. For depicting the nomogram of BP for the age chart, we used the Lowess method for smoothing the curve. We depicted the nomogram of systolic and diastolic BPs against age (in months) for the 50th centile for height for each sex.

Results

We analyzed the data of 15,936 boys and 1,04,132 girls. The mean age of both girls and boys was 17.07 years each. The maximum number of individuals were from Uttar Pradesh (n = 23,470), followed by Madhya Pradesh (n = 12588) and Bihar (n = 10315). Lakshadweep (n = 130), followed by Chandigarh (n = 132), and Dadra and Nagar Haveli (n = 164) had the minimum number of individuals. The majority of the survey participants were from rural areas (73.45%). The flow chart for the selection of the participants is shown in Figure 1. In total, we used data of 90.6% girls and 87.5% boys in the age group of 15–19 years.

Nomogram for BP of boys and girls is shown in [Figures 2 and 3]. Only 50th, 90th, and 95th systolic and diastolic BP centiles were included as they provided information on the median values and cut-off values for hypertension and elevated BP. The BP (both systolic and diastolic) between the 90th and 95th centile lines represents elevated BP and the BP of more than 95th centile lines represents stage 1 hypertension. Furthermore, values of more than 99th centile representing stage 2 hypertension can be found in the supplementary tables. Supplementary tables (S1S4) provide complete percentile values of systolic and diastolic BP according to gender, age (in months), and height-for-age centiles.

Both systolic and diastolic BP increased with age and height centiles. The BP was higher in boys than in girls. An average annual increase in the systolic and diastolic BP was 2.52 and 1.20 mmHg in boys; and 0.50 and 0.46 mmHg in girls, respectively, when adjusted for height centiles (Supplementary Tables S1S4).

Discussion

In the current study, we present the nomogram of BP among adolescent boys and girls between ages 15 and 19 years. Hypertension among adolescents is a prevalent but often undiagnosed condition. The categorization of BP into elevated BP (BP >90th centile) and hypertension (BP >95th centile) also helps to identify the individual children based on their risk profile.[2] The normative values of BP depend on the age, sex, and height centile of the individual.

While there are other studies from India, most of them are on smaller samples that are not nationally represented.[7,13,14] A study by Raj M, et al.[7] conducted among non-overweight school-going children, the estimated cut-off BPs to be 130/86 and 133/88 among boys of ages 15 and 16 years at the 50th height centile for age; and 133/89 each among girls of ages 15 and 16 years at the 50th height centile for age. For the same age groups in our study, the cut-offs were 124/82 and 126/84 for boys of ages 15 and 16 years; and 126/84 each for girls of ages 15 and 16 years. The higher values of BPs in the study by Raj M, et al.[7] can be because the BP measurements were taken in school, while in the NFHS-4 survey, the measurements were taken in home settings.

Compared with the latest guidelines by the American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P), we see that among boys, the 90th centile for systolic BP is less than 130 mmHg up to about 210 months (18th year of life), while the 95th centile is less than 140 mmHg in all the age groups and all height centiles. Among girls, the systolic BP is always less than the cut-offs prescribed for pre-hypertension and hypertension. Hence, using the recent AAP cut-offs, pre-hypertension and hypertension would be underdiagnosed using the systolic BP criteria. However, for diastolic BP among both boys and girls, while the 90th centile is more than 80 mmHg, the 95th centile is less than 90 mmHg in all ages. Hence, hypertension would be underdiagnosed using the diastolic criteria. One of the aims of diagnosing pre-hypertension is to diagnose the underlying diseases, and if they are not present, to start early in life, the necessary lifestyle changes. For these reasons, a lower cut-off should be more appropriate.

The strength of this study is that we used a nationally representative sample from a large survey in which BP was measured using a standard apparatus and standard method. The current BP nomogram, thus, is applicable in Indian settings.

There are a few limitations to this study. First, since there are no data on co-morbidity, adolescents with morbidities such as chronic kidney disease, sleep disorders, endocrine abnormalities, or prematurely born adolescents would also be included. Second, obesity was not considered for the nomogram. Previous research has shown that an increase in BMI for age among adolescents leads to an increase in systolic and diastolic BP.[15,16,17] Considering children in the normal range of BMI-for-age will lead to a lower cut-off for both systolic and diastolic BPs. In our dataset, there were 513 (3.2%) boys and 2,801 (2.7%) girls who were obese, with BMI-for-age more than 3 SD. Due to these two factors, the normative values of BP might have been overestimated.

Conclusion and Recommendations

The current BP nomogram can be generalized to the Indian population. Further research is required for the diagnostic performance of this nomogram for the diagnosis of adolescent hypertension.
